Explore the fundamentals of quantum chemistry in this comprehensive lecture from the Quantum Wave in Computing Boot Camp. Delve into electronic structure problems, learn about creation and annihilation operators, and understand Hartree Fock and configuration interaction methods. Discover how quantum chemistry can be applied on quantum computers, including fermion-qubit mappings, variational quantum eigensolver, and quantum phase estimation. Gain insights into adiabatic state preparation and Hamiltonian simulation techniques. Presented by Bryan O'Gorman from UC Berkeley and NASA Ames, this talk provides a solid foundation for understanding the intersection of quantum mechanics and computational chemistry.
